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: B-ultrasound to confirm pregnancy; 18-45 years old; gestational age 7-14 weeks; Patients with NVP with a Pregnancy-Unique Quantification of Emesis and Nausea (PUQE) score of >= 6; patient does not respond to conservative treatment including diet/lifestyle recommendations, according to the 2004 ACOG Practice Bulletin; The patient does not intend to terminate the pregnancy; Patient has signed written informed consent to participate in the study and agrees to follow the trial instructions and complete all required study visits.
